Step-by-step timeline
Submit Your Donation Form
Complete our straightforward online form with information about your vehicle. This is the first step in starting your donation journey.
Receive Confirmation
Once we receive your form, a representative will review it and contact you to discuss pickup options and confirm all details.
Schedule Towing Appointment
We will work with you to arrange a convenient time for the tow truck to arrive, typically within 24-72 hours depending on your location.
Prepare Your Vehicle
On the scheduled day, ensure you have the title and keys ready. Our tow truck operator will arrive, ready to assist with the pickup process.
Free Pickup and Towing
The tow truck will arrive at the agreed time, and after a quick inspection, your vehicle will be loaded up and taken away—towing is completely free!
What you need ready
- Vehicle title (if available)
- Keys to the vehicle
- Signed release form
- Confirmation of pickup address
- Clear access path for tow truck

How pickup logistics work
Our dispatcher works closely with a network of local towing providers to ensure a smooth pickup process. Once your donation form is submitted, the dispatcher will coordinate with the tow operator to establish a pickup time. Communication is key; you can expect a call from the tow truck driver before arrival to confirm details and answer any last-minute questions about the pickup.
Arizona pickup notes
In Arizona, we have a dense network of tow operators to assist with vehicle pickups, particularly in urban and suburban areas which allows for quick scheduling. However, in rural regions, towing can be less predictable due to fewer resources and potential HOA regulations or street-parking rules that might affect accessibility. Donors should be aware of these conditions and communicate any concerns during the scheduling process to ensure a smooth pickup.
